Transaction 429b50af4001667bb7c785d611e8133ab613362abea90ef59859cb672a1a19ae
1 Input
1 Output
-
429b50af4001667bb7c785d611e8133ab613362abea90ef59859cb672a1a19ae:0
- value
- 24627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edf54d6e2408a32597c412b42559e00537db0876 OP_EQUAL
- address
- 3PPDvvPtVE1estyg8UTJ3fnYNg3wwmfpmM